CVE-2003-0947

30
FAUCET Score

CVE-2003-0947 describes a buffer overflow vulnerability in the iwconfig utility, part of the wireless_tools project. When iwconfig is installed with setuid permissions, a local attacker can exploit this flaw by providing an overly long OUT environment variable, leading to arbitrary code execution. This vulnerability carries a high CVSS score of 7.2, indicating critical impact with local access, low attack complexity, and complete comp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ability. While not listed in CISA's KEV catalog, multiple exploit proofs-of-concept are publicly available on ExploitDB, though there is no evidence of active exploitation or significant community discussion.
